Last weekend was a legendary one in hip-hop, as Kendrick Lamar and Drake fired off various diss records agains each other. Kendrick dropped off four for that weekend, as Drake released two. As a result, many crowned Kendrick as the winner in this beef that has publicly been lingering since late March. Kendrick’s disses have included accusing Drake of hiding an 11-year-old daughter, as well as pedophilia.

Meanwhile, Top Dawg Entertainment founder Anthony “Top Dawg” Tiffith took to Twitter/X on Friday night, to crown Kendrick as the winner in this beef with Drake. Kendrick had been signed to TDE since the late 2000s, up until his latest studio album, “Mr. Morale & The Big Steppers,” in 2022. That debuted atop the Billboard 200 chart, and won Best Rap Album at the Grammys.

“This battle is over,” Anthony Tiffith explained. “A win for the culture, while keeping it all on wax. Especially when these publications try to make it something else. We proved them wrong. That’s a victory within itself. On another note, it’s time to wrap up this TDE 20yr anniversary compilation.”

Kendrick’s last Drake diss was “Not Like Us,” last weekend. There, he emphasized that Drake and his crew are involved in pedophilia. Therefore, Drake’s response came last Sunday, which was “The Heart Part 6.” That was named after Kendrick’s “The Heart Part 5,” as many seemed to believe that Drake sounded defeated, and didn’t try hard to deny allegations against him.

Furthermore, Kendrick’s Not Like Us is also expected to debut atop the Billboard Hot 100. Moreover, this includes having the biggest US streaming debut for a solo hip-hop single, in this decade.
